Landlords must ensure they comply with local pet regulations, including any breed or size restrictions, and may require additional security deposits for pet owners.
It’s crucial for prospective tenants to review the lease agreement carefully regarding pet policies. This includes understanding the number of pets allowed, weight limits, and any specific rules about pet behavior and cleanliness. While many pet-friendly apartments in Albany naturally accommodate pets, it is vital to verify these details beforehand to avoid unforeseen issues. Tenants should also be aware of their responsibilities, such as ensuring their pets are properly trained, vaccinated, and not causing disturbances to neighbors. One key aspect to consider is the specific pet policy of each apartment complex. Some allow dogs and cats, while others may have restrictions on breed, size, or number. It’s crucial to review these policies carefully and ask about any additional requirements during your tour. Transitioning smoothly involves preparing both you and your pet for their new surroundings. This could include introducing them to the apartment gradually, establishing a routine, and providing them with comfortable spaces to retreat to. Additionally, connecting with neighbors who have pets can foster a supportive environment where owners can share advice and resources.
